In a short span, fintech has emerged as the fastest-growing industry. The fintech landscape driven by technological evolution is estimated to rise sixfold from $245 billion to $1.5 trillion by 2030, with Asia-Pacific peripheries leading the charge to become the top fintech market, surmounting the US. Backed by a growing populace of tech-savvy professionals, sizable underbanked sectors and an innovation acumen, India is certainly not behind in the fintech race. As a result, it is gearing up to redefine the future of the global fintech scenario.

Convergence of Financial Inclusion and Well-Being 

Bridging the financial inclusion gap has always been a priority for fintechs. By leveraging innovative tech tools to seamlessly assess creditworthiness, it has delivered promising financial service solutions to the underserved populace. In 2024, this inclusion will foray into the welltech sector which will focus on integrating financial wealth with well-being. Further, the emergence of open banking and API models will enable welltech fintech lenders to make informed decisions about borrowers’ repayment capacity, resulting in expedited loan disbursals. 

Working towards cultivating an equitable well-being financial space, he further added, “In 2024, the true Welltech fintech platforms would see a strategic shift towards vertically-focused innovation, wherein generic financial solutions will give way to deep industry understanding, user behaviour analysis, and tailored underwriting and collection models. This isn't just niche play; it's precision finance. By leveraging profound sector knowledge and offering hyper-relevant financial products, insurtech platforms will be able to deliver real-time lending tailored to the needs of patients.”

Explosion of Mobile Payments 

In the anticipated fintech trends for 2024, Manish Kumar Shukla, Co-founder, of CheqUPI, said, “The surge in mobile payments driven by the escalating value of digital wallet transactions, will be the much-awaited innovation in the digital payment ecosystem. While, the advent of UPI has played a transformative role in the fintech industry, allowing players to seamlessly integrate its features into a myriad of applications and make payments from any remote corner of the country. But in 2024, this integration will spur the creation of numerous innovative solutions.”

Accelerating the ongoing transition towards digital transactions, he commented further, “ Underlining the broader evolution in digital payment preferences, the world will witness a rise in digital wallets, investment platforms, lending apps, expense trackers, and more. Additionally, the increasing popularity of buy now, pay later (BNPL) options, microloans, and personalised investment opportunities will contribute to fostering diverse and engaged user bases worldwide.” 

Invincible AI and ML movement 

The fintech sector is experiencing a revolutionary shift marked by continuous innovations and advancements. With evolution across diverse verticals, from healthcare to finance, AI and ML are poised to play an increasingly important role. In the financial sector, the co-founder of CheqUPI stated, “AI applications will metamorphose risk assessment, strengthen fraud detection and redefine customer services to guarantee personalized financial experiences.”

Furthermore, the augment of Generative AI will seismically alter complex processes such as conversational AI, code generation, design automation and many more, enhancing the productivity and efficiency of employees and the profitability of the business. AI-assisted chatbots will gain prominence, given their ability to expedite customer ticket processing. Last but not least, AI will be instrumental in streamlining payment flow, by connecting customers with accessible payment options.
